π¦ Peacock officially represents the bird known for its iridescent tail feathers and pride,
Officialπ¦ Butterfly officially symbolizes the winged insect associated with metamorphosis and nature.
π¦ is used by Gen Z to signal showing off, extra behavior, or flexing aesthetics,
Genzπ¦ is used to represent personal growth, transformation, or that fluttery anxious feeling in the stomach.
π¦ carries emotions of vanity, confidence, and self-display, whereas π¦ evokes feelings of hope, change, freedom, and gentle beauty.
Emotionalπ¦ in dating contexts suggests someone who is showy, high-maintenance, or trying too hard to impress,
Datingπ¦ is used to describe butterflies in the stomach, new crushes, or a blossoming romantic connection.
π¦ appears in memes about peacocking, flexing too hard, or being unnecessarily dramatic,
Memeπ¦ is iconic in the 'Is this a pigeon?' meme format and is used broadly for labeling misidentified things.
π¦ trends on TikTok in fashion, aesthetic, and luxury content where creators show off bold looks,
Tiktokπ¦ dominates TikTok in glow-up transformations, mental health journeys, and cottagecore aesthetic videos.
π¦ is occasionally sent on WhatsApp to compliment someone's bold or beautiful style,
Whatsappπ¦ is far more commonly used in everyday WhatsApp chats to express excitement, love, or emotional support.
Use π¦ when you want to convey showiness, luxury aesthetics, bold self-expression, or call someone out for being extra. Use π¦ when discussing personal growth, new beginnings, romantic excitement, or emotional vulnerability. π¦ works in almost any casual or heartfelt context, while π¦ is best saved for fashion, flex culture, or dramatic flair.
